Wheelchair basketball player Patrick Anderson and swimmer Katarina Roxon have been named Canada’s flag-bearers for the opening ceremonies of the Paralympic Games in Paris.
Roxon, a two-time Paralympic medallist and Anderson, who has four medals under his belt, will lead the Canadian delegation at Place de la Concorde on Aug. 28 at 1:20 p.m. ET.
